Sri Lanka Navy assists National Oil Spill Combat Exercise (SPILLEX 2017)
 

Continuing her responsibility on the imperative matters of Maritime affairs, Sri Lanka Navy rendered assistance in the National Oil Spill Combat Exercise (SPILLEX 2017) which was organized by Marine Environment Protection Authority, at the seas off Colombo harbour and the Galle Face, on 14th and 15th December.

This exercise was carried out to rehearse and test the capabilities of the stake holders who are responsible to act during an oil spill as per the National Oil Spill Contingency Plan. The Navy team engaged in the exercise on both days, was comprised of 70 naval personnel including two Fast Attack Craft, an Inshore Patrol Craft, Fire Fighting Team and a Search & Rescue Team.

Sri Lanka Coast Guard, Sri Lanka Army, Sri Lanka Air Force, Sri Lanka Police, National Aquatic Resources Agency, Sri Lanka Ports Authority, Ceylon Petroleum Cooperation, Ceylon Petroleum Storage Terminals Ltd. and other responsible organizations also participated in the exercise.
